Ravenhall Prison – another shining example of long term infrastructure financing

7 Jun 2019, by Informa Insights

Prison infrastructure – and public works more generally – is seeing a renaissance in long term financing solutions after a temporary decline in popularity following the GFC.

The Ravenhall Prison Public Private Partnership (PPP) has just completed a long term financing transaction, on which Allens advised The GEO Group.

Ahead of Informa’s Prisons 2019 Conference, Allens Partner David Donnelly, says, “From equity’s perspective, securing long term, fixed rate debt that takes you to the end of the concession life is a pretty smart move”.

“There is no refinancing risk and no need to hedge. This ultimately gives greater certainty to project investors and their government clients, in a way that the traditional mini-perm structure does not”.

The Ravenhall Prison project was designed and built and is being operated and maintained by The Geo Consortium through a PPP arrangement involving The Geo Group Australia, Capella Capital, Correct Care, Honeywell, John Holland and Forensicare, among others.

Allens has advised the Geo Consortium throughout the project lifecycle, from the initial bid for the development of the asset in 2013, through construction and commissioning, until the present steady state of operation with an accompanying long-term debt solution.

This work has seen Allens winning awards such as ‘Advisory Excellence’ and ‘Project of the Year’ at the Infrastructure Partnerships Australia Awards in 2014 and 2018 respectively.

“Now that we have a couple of positive recent examples, there is a precedent for investors on both sides – project owners and bond investors – and a bit more momentum to continue the trend of long term financing”, added David.

“The Ravenhall transaction marks yet another successful milestone. The project has been delivered on time and within budget and received a very good response from the market. It has provided a shining example of the government backing itself and the private sector effectively responding to the challenge. I hope it will encourage governments to be more ambitious in this space going forward”.
